An extremely mild method for the transformation of propiolic esters to β-keto esters via thiol addition is reported, including its successful application to the synthesis of (±)-thienamycin.
A mild and efficient method for the conversion of propiolic esters to β-keto esters was developed. Initially, propiolic esters were converted to β-phenylthio-α, β-unsaturated esters, which were treated with N-bromoacetamide in an aqueous solvent followed by reductive debromination with an aqueous solution of sodium sulfite, affording β-keto esters in good yields. Using this new method, a formal total synthesis of (±)-thienamycin from 4-propargyl-2-azetidinone was accomplished.
